Logo Design Challenge
I started to become more interested in identity design and the way many logos included hidden elements within their design. I sought a way to improve my own skills in this area and came across the Daily Logo Challenge; this challenge consisted of one email a day for 50 straight days containing a simple logo prompt and hypothetical company names (whether you used the names or not was up to you). I spent anywhere from 1.5 to 6 hours each day, sketching ideas and vectorizing a logo with different color schemes. Being able to try different ideas and be as creative as possible, while also expanding my skill set in a fun and challenging way, really showed me the endless possibilities of logo design.
While I was not able to complete all 50 days in a row, I am currently working on completing the remaining 13 days worth of logos and will add them to this page as soon as possible.
